LJT00RE-11-99SF Overview

MIL Series Connector, 7 Contact(s), Aluminum Alloy, Female, Crimp Terminal, Receptacle

LJT00RE-11-99SF Parametric

Parameter NameAttribute value
MakerAmphenol
Reach Compliance Codeunknown
Other featuresSTANDARD:MIL-DTL-38999
Back shell typeSOLID
Body/casing typeRECEPTACLE
Connector typeMIL SERIES CONNECTOR
Contact point genderFEMALE
Coupling typeBAYONET
DIN complianceNO
empty shellNO
Environmental characteristicsENVIRONMENT RESISTANT
Filter functionNO
IEC complianceNO
MIL complianceYES
Manufacturer's serial numberLJT
Mixed contactsNO
Installation typeCABLE AND PANEL
OptionsGENERAL PURPOSE
Shell surfaceNICKEL
Shell materialALUMINUM ALLOY
Housing size11
Termination typeCRIMP
Total number of contacts7
